What is House Rekeying?
House rekeying is the process of changing the internal parts of a lock so that it can be run by a brand-new key. Rather than replacing the whole lock system, rekeying allows for a more economical solution while boosting security. A trained locksmith performs this service by modifying the lock's tumblers to match a new key, therefore rendering any formerly released keys worthless.

The Rekeying Process
The rekeying procedure normally involves the following steps:
Assessment: The locksmith examines the existing locking system to identify if it can be rekeyed. A lot of basic pin tumbler locks can be rekeyed.
Disassembly: The locksmith gets rid of the lock from the door as well as the cylinder.
Changing Pins: Inside the cylinder, old pins are replaced with new ones. Each pin corresponds to a particular cut on the key.
Testing: The brand-new key is inserted into the lock to guarantee it runs smoothly and securely.
Reinstallation: Once verified, the locksmith will place the lock back on the door.

How much does it cost to rekey a house?
The cost differs based on the locksmith's rates, the variety of locks being rekeyed, and your place. Usually, the expense varies from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50 per lock.
How long does rekeying take?
The majority of rekeying tasks can be completed within 30 minutes to an hour, depending upon the complexity of the lock system.
Can all locks be rekeyed?
While lots of standard pin tumbler locks can be rekeyed, particular high-security locks may require customized services.
Is rekeying the exact same as changing a lock?
No, rekeying modifies the internal functions of an existing lock so it can be run by a brand-new key, while changing a lock entails completely replacing it with a new system.
Do I need to have all the initial secrets for rekeying?
No, it is not needed to have the initial keys, however having them may expedite the procedure.
